Araştırma Makalesi

Solving an Order Batching and Sequencing Problem with Reinforcement Learning

Cilt: 36 Sayı: 3 26 Eylül 2024
PDF İndir
TR EN

Solving an Order Batching and Sequencing Problem with Reinforcement Learning

Öz

The purpose of this research is to determine whether a DRL solution would be a suitable solution for the OBSP problem and to compare it with traditional methods. For this purpose, models trained utilizing the PPO algorithm were tested in a complex and realistic warehouse environment, and an attempt was made to measure whether a strategy was developed to decrease the number of orders being late. A heuristic method was also applied and the results were compared on the same environment and data. The results showed that DRL approach that combines heuristics with the PPO algorithm outperforms the heuristics in minimizing the tardy order percentage in all tested scenarios.

Anahtar Kelimeler

Teşekkür

This research was prepared within the scope of Bahçeşehir University postgraduate thesis study. I would like to express my gratitude to my supervisor Assos. Prof. Ayla Gülcü for her valuable guidance and advice which makes this study possible.

Kaynakça

  1. Cals, B. J. H. C. (2019). The order batching problem: a deep reinforcement learning approach. (Master Thesis, Eindhoven University of Technology, Eindhoven, Holland). Retrieved from https://research.tue.nl/en/studentTheses/the-order-batching-problem
  2. Menéndez, B., Bustillo, M., G. Pardo, E., & Duarte, A. (2017). General Variable Neighborhood Search for the Order Batching and Sequencing Problem. European Journal of Operational Research. 263. 10.1016/j.ejor.2017.05.001.
  3. Xiaowei, J., Zhou, Y., Zhang, Y., Sun, L., & Hu, X. (2018). Order batching and sequencing problem under the pick-and-sort strategy in online supermarkets. Procedia Computer Science. 126. 1985-1993. 10.1016/j.procs.2018.07.254.
  4. Aylak, B. L. (2022). WAREHOUSE LAYOUT OPTIMIZATION USING ASSOCIATION RULES. FRESENIUS ENVIRONMENTAL BULLETIN, 31(3 A), 3828-3840.
  5. Beeks, M. S. (2021). Deep reinforcement learning for solving a multi-objective online order batching problem. (Master Thesis, Eindhoven University of Technology, Eindhoven, Holland). Retrieved from https://research.tue.nl/en/studentTheses/deep-reinforcement-learning-for-solving-a-multi-objective-online-
  6. Boysen, N., De Koster, R.B.M, & Weidinger, F. (2018). Warehousing in the e-commerce era: A survey. European Journal of Operational Research. 277. 10.1016/j.ejor.2018.08.023.
  7. Aylak, B. L., İnce, M., Oral, O., Süer, G., Almasarwah, N., Singh, M., & Salah, B. (2021). Application of machine learning methods for pallet loading problem. Applied Sciences, 11(18), 8304.
  8. Yan, Y., Chow, A.H.F., Ho, C.P., Kuo, Y.H., Wu, Q., & Ying, C. (2021). Reinforcement Learning for Logistics and Supply Chain Management: Methodologies, State of the Art, and Future Opportunities. Retrieved from SSRN: https://ssrn.com/abstract=3935816

Ayrıntılar

Birincil Dil

İngilizce

Konular

Yazılım Mühendisliği (Diğer)

Bölüm

Araştırma Makalesi

Erken Görünüm Tarihi

19 Eylül 2024

Yayımlanma Tarihi

26 Eylül 2024

Gönderilme Tarihi

29 Nisan 2024

Kabul Tarihi

27 Haziran 2024

Yayımlandığı Sayı

Yıl 2024 Cilt: 36 Sayı: 3

Kaynak Göster

APA
Canaslan, B., & Gülcü, A. (2024). Solving an Order Batching and Sequencing Problem with Reinforcement Learning. International Journal of Advances in Engineering and Pure Sciences, 36(3), 235-246. https://doi.org/10.7240/jeps.1475312
AMA
1.Canaslan B, Gülcü A. Solving an Order Batching and Sequencing Problem with Reinforcement Learning. JEPS. 2024;36(3):235-246. doi:10.7240/jeps.1475312
Chicago
Canaslan, Begüm, ve Ayla Gülcü. 2024. “Solving an Order Batching and Sequencing Problem with Reinforcement Learning”. International Journal of Advances in Engineering and Pure Sciences 36 (3): 235-46. https://doi.org/10.7240/jeps.1475312.
EndNote
Canaslan B, Gülcü A (01 Eylül 2024) Solving an Order Batching and Sequencing Problem with Reinforcement Learning. International Journal of Advances in Engineering and Pure Sciences 36 3 235–246.
IEEE
[1]B. Canaslan ve A. Gülcü, “Solving an Order Batching and Sequencing Problem with Reinforcement Learning”, JEPS, c. 36, sy 3, ss. 235–246, Eyl. 2024, doi: 10.7240/jeps.1475312.
ISNAD
Canaslan, Begüm - Gülcü, Ayla. “Solving an Order Batching and Sequencing Problem with Reinforcement Learning”. International Journal of Advances in Engineering and Pure Sciences 36/3 (01 Eylül 2024): 235-246. https://doi.org/10.7240/jeps.1475312.
JAMA
1.Canaslan B, Gülcü A. Solving an Order Batching and Sequencing Problem with Reinforcement Learning. JEPS. 2024;36:235–246.
MLA
Canaslan, Begüm, ve Ayla Gülcü. “Solving an Order Batching and Sequencing Problem with Reinforcement Learning”. International Journal of Advances in Engineering and Pure Sciences, c. 36, sy 3, Eylül 2024, ss. 235-46, doi:10.7240/jeps.1475312.
Vancouver
1.Begüm Canaslan, Ayla Gülcü. Solving an Order Batching and Sequencing Problem with Reinforcement Learning. JEPS. 01 Eylül 2024;36(3):235-46. doi:10.7240/jeps.1475312